1. Figure out how to Beat the Micro Stakes First


Presently I should concede, my first web-based poker tip for you isn't the most well known one all the time. Also that is to begin at the miniature stakes.


However, what does the "miniature stakes" even mean?


Whenever I utilize the term miniature stakes in internet based poker I am essentially alluding to the 1cent/2cent visually impaired games (2NL) as far as possible up until the 25cent/50cent visually impaired games (50NL).


Presently some web-based poker destinations nowadays start at 2cent/5cent visually impaired games or even 5cent/10cent visually impaired games. My recommendation however is to constantly begin at the least stake accessible.


I realize everyone needs to play high stakes and bring in the huge cash yet assuming you are new to online poker or battling to win up to this point, it is truly essential that you figure out how to crush the awful players at as far as possible first.


What's more the justification for what reason is on the grounds that this will drive you to dominate the essentials, which will help you colossally while managing the a lot more grounded rivalry that you will look in higher stakes poker games.


Regardless of whether you are an extremely experienced poker player (maybe with an extensive live foundation), I actually suggesting beginning at the miniature stakes for up to 14 days just to demonstrate that you can undoubtedly beat these players.


If it's not too much trouble, accept me when I say that internet based poker is no stroll in the park any longer at mid stakes or high stakes. By this I mean stakes of like 100NL (50c/$1 blind games) and higher.


It is truly vital to demonstrate that you can beat the lower stakes first or you won't have a potential for success in these higher stakes games.


2. Continuously Enter the Pot With a Raise Preflop


Another of my best web-based poker tips is to constantly enter the pot preflop with a raise.


Presently I realize this could sound a piece insane at first particularly assuming you come from a live poker foundation where limping (simply calling the visually impaired preflop) is significantly more normal.


Be that as it may, in web-based poker limping is substantially less predominant. Furthermore without a doubt, on the off chance that you really do limp a ton, all things considered, one of the more grounded players will begin disconnecting you oftentimes and making your life troublesome after the lemon.


Here is an ideal illustration of a why I don't propose limping frequently in internet based poker:


As may be obvious, it causes what is going on that I like to call "the compounding phenomenon."


It is quite often a superior thought when you are playing on the web poker to just assume responsibility for the pot immediately before the failure with a raise.


I suggest raising it 3x the huge visually impaired. Furthermore you ought to likewise add an additional one major visually impaired for every limper. Besides, you likewise need to add an extra large visually impaired, per limper, assuming that you are out of position.


For those of you who have perused Crushing the Microstakes you will realize that this is the specific preflop raising framework that I illustrated in the book.


Presently I realize this can be in every way a piece mistaking for newbies to poker however so let me clarify this with a couple of models:


Model #1 (standard raise):


It is collapsed to you on the button 바카라사이트 with A♥J♣ in a NL10 Zoom 6max money game.


You should raise it to 30 pennies.


Model #2 (raise over limpers ready):


Two individuals limp and you are on the button with A♥J♣ in a NL10 Zoom 6max money game.


You should raise it to 50 pennies.


Model #3 (raise over limpers out of position):


Two individuals limp and you are in the huge visually impaired with A♥J♣ in a NL10 Zoom 6max money game.


You should raise it to 70 pennies.


The justification for why it is smarter to reliably assume responsibility for the pot preflop like this (rather than simply limping along), is on the grounds that it gives you a lot more ways of winning the pot.


You have precisely the same chances of winning the pot by just making the best hand after the failure. Yet, by raising preflop you have likewise given yourself two extra ways of winning the pot.


You can now likewise win the pot by basically constraining them to all overlap preflop. Or on the other hand you can win the pot by going on with the tension and constraining them to overlap on the lemon, turn or stream.


Folks, one of the greatest key standards of winning poker is providing yourself with the most extreme measure of ways of winning the pot.


By reliably being the attacker in the hand preflop you quite often give yourself more ways of winning.


3. You Should Often Re-Raise Preflop too


Another of my best internet based poker tips is to re-raise frequently before the lemon too. This is likewise alluded to as a "3-bet" coincidentally.


The justification for why you need to be re-raising preflop a fair piece is for comparative reasons. It essentially gives us more ways of winning the pot.


We can bring it down preflop, we can make the best hand postflop or we can compel them out of the pot after the failure by going on with the hostility (seriously wagering or raising).


Presently, you would rather not go off the deep end with 3-wagering in low stakes games since you will get called a considerable amount. In any case, when you have a solid premium hand like:

AA

KK

QQ

JJ

AK


Then, at that point, you ought to be re-raising preflop regularly.


The main genuine exemption is the point 에볼루션게이밍 at which a tight player brings up in early position since they will be on an exceptionally limited scope of incredibly impressive hands.


By the way these are the seats straightforwardly to one side of the blinds.


Whenever a player (who is now close) raises from these seats we ought to anticipate that they should have an extremely impressive reach. Perhaps as restricted as 88, 99, TT, JJ, QQ, KK, AA, AQ and AK.


So thusly it can frequently appear to be legit to just level call to control the size of the pot with a superior hand like TT, JJ, QQ or AK.


Furthermore on the off chance that we are nutted with AA or KK, it can likewise seem OK to simply level call here to keep them in the pot. We additionally get to play our hand ready in the two situations (enormous benefit).


Be that as it may, in a real sense any remaining cases you should basically be 3-wagering (re-raising) when you have one of these superior hands.


However, you likewise need to do some "light 3-wagering" also. This implies that you are deciding to re-lift for certain speculative hands.


This makes you a lot harder to play against generally.


Once more and, position matters a ton here. You essentially need to be light 3-wagering when the activity is around the button or it is visually impaired versus blind.


Ensure that you don't light 3-bet someone who raises from early situation for every one of the reasons that we recently examined.


The following are a couple of the hands I like to light 3-bet with:

A♣9♣

6♥6♠

J♦T♦


However, you additionally need to be definitely mindful of the player type. The most ideal sort of player to focus with a light 3-bet is a feeble player.


This implies they are extremely reluctant to play a major pot without a major hand. This is the place where utilizing a HUD can truly prove to be useful while playing on the web poker.


Simply target individuals who have a Fold to 3-bet detail of 70% or higher.
